Subject: Handover — Dripstone dedup service

Taking over from this week: Dripstone, our alert deduplicator, is stable but the fingerprint cache on node two fills up roughly every ten days. When it does, duplicate pages slip through for a few minutes until the eviction job runs. I bumped the cache TTL on Tuesday; watch whether that holds. Config lives in the usual repo under /dedup. If the suppression rules start eating real alerts, pause the service and write to the platform team here.

escalation mailbox, bafog-fafog: ulador@paliqlabs.internal

## Runbook: Breakwall Release

Breakwall guards the Tollridge upstream API. Cut from `release/next`. Verify trip thresholds match the config freeze. Run the failover smoke test; abort on any open-state flapping. Tag, build, then sign the artifact before the gate check. Sign with the key below.

signing key of baduf-taweg = bky6_Zf7bem

## Step 4: Update your plugin manifest for Flagwright 3.x

Before registering hooks, plugin authors must migrate from the legacy `rollout.yml` format to the new staged-cohort schema. Flagwright 3.x evaluates cohorts in declaration order, so list your most restrictive segments first. Note that the `gradual` strategy now requires an explicit ceiling percentage; omitting it will cause registration to fail at load time. Once your manifest validates, apply the service configuration exactly as shown below.

service settings:
PRAIX_LOG_LEVEL=error
PRAIX_METRICS_HOST=metrics.praix.qorvelcorp.corp
PRAIX_POOL_SIZE=16

# Break-Glass: Catalog Cache Invalidation

Scope: the Pinrow product catalog at Veldstone Retail. If stale prices persist after a purge and the Hollowmere invalidation queue is wedged, use break-glass to flush the edge tier directly. Contractors: get verbal sign-off from the catalog lead first. Steps: open the Hollowmere admin shell, select emergency-flush, confirm the tenant, and run it once — repeated flushes thrash the origin. Access is logged and expires after 20 minutes. Unseal the admin shell with the passphrase below.

recovery phrase for kahop-tajog: istix-casvan